    Ward is one of what i call the ''new school U.S fighters''. He has gifts of speed in hand and foot and ability to box and razzle dazzle but chooses to be a very astute tactical fighter who adds different components to his skillset. Him,Bradley and a few others are now not relying on there physical blessings. They rely on solid gameplans and the fact they can adapt in the fights.

    These lads are anything but spectacular but are very very effective. The lads for real and only have to watch his last three displays. This will be the acid test when his physical advantages are matched and bettered and he must now think of a way to engage the running man Dirrell.
